Introduction: Why Customer Reviews Matter More Than Ever
In the current digital economy, customer feedback have become one of the most powerful factors that determine whether a business thrives or struggles.
Modern https://jemimazmdn768539.empirewiki.com/9643782/localmator_review_the_innovative_tool_transforming_online_reputation